Why is the Shoulder Joint Important?

The shoulder is one of the most mobile joints in the body, allowing you to lift, reach, rotate, and carry. It’s made up of the humerus (upper arm bone), scapula (shoulder blade), and clavicle (collarbone)—held together by muscles, tendons, and ligaments.

When the shoulder joint is damaged by arthritis, injury, or degeneration, it can lead to:

  • Pain

  • Loss of motion

  • Weakness

  • Difficulty performing everyday tasks like dressing, lifting, or sleeping comfortably

What is Shoulder Replacement Surgery?

Shoulder replacement surgery involves removing the damaged parts of the joint and replacing them with artificial components (prosthetics) to restore smooth, pain-free movement.

There are two main types:

1. Total Shoulder Replacement (Anatomic)

This is used when the rotator cuff muscles are intact but the joint is worn down by arthritis or injury.

  • The damaged ball (humeral head) is replaced with a smooth metal ball.

  • The socket (glenoid) is replaced with a durable plastic surface.

  • The artificial components mimic the natural anatomy of the shoulder.

✅ Ideal for osteoarthritis, fractures, or degenerative joint disease with a healthy rotator cuff.

2. Reverse Shoulder Replacement

This is done when the rotator cuff is torn or not functioning properly.

  • The normal ball-and-socket structure is reversed: the ball is placed on the shoulder blade, and the socket is placed on the upper arm.

  • This allows the deltoid muscle to take over movement normally handled by the rotator cuff.

✅ Ideal for large rotator cuff tears, complex fractures, or failed previous surgeries.

How is the Procedure Performed?

Most modern shoulder replacements are done using minimally invasive surgical techniques:

  • Smaller incisions to reduce muscle damage

  • Use of 3D imaging and intraoperative navigation for precision

  • Advanced implant materials designed for longevity and mobility

  • Typically performed under regional anesthesia with sedation
